Today Akshay Tritiya is being celebrated, so this day is considered special?

Kathmandu: The Akshay Tritiya festival, which is celebrated every year on the day of Baisakh Shukla Tritiya, is being celebrated today by donating and consuming everything.

According to the classical law, it is decided to get up early this morning, cover the house, take a bath and prepare worship items. Diyo, Kalash and Ganesha are worshiped by placing a copper plate with Ashta Dal inscribed on the Kalash.

There is a Vedic orthodox tradition of offering pure water in a copper or earthen vessel to the priest and donating pitha and barley flour mixed with cinnamon, cloves, sweetmeat, cardamom, honey, sugar, sugarcane and sugarcane.

It is described in various Puranas that the good deeds done on this day including bathing, almsgiving, meditation and chanting will never be destroyed. Since barley is similar to nectar in the summer of Satu and Vaishakh, it is a tradition from Vedic times to donate and eat it yourself.

Prof. Dr. Ram Chandra Gautam, a theologian and chairman of the Nepal Panchang Judging Committee, says that both things will help to save the body from heat and will also get strength from it. It is also said to help boost the body's immune system. Ayurvedic doctors say that Satu and Sarvat increase the human body's resistance to disease when the infection of Kovid-19 spreads rapidly.

"Even if you donate a little on the day of Vaishakh Shukla Tritiya, you will get a lot of fruits and it is indestructible, that is, it will never perish. Today, this day is called Akshaya Tritiya. , He said.

Ghada donated today is also called Dharmaghatadi donation. Today it is customary to donate umbrellas, sticks and cloth shoes to the elderly and to donate cows, land, grain and gold to the deserving Brahmins. Such donations are also made to the helpless and destitute. It is believed that Aradhyadeva Mahadev and Parvati, the daughter of Himalayas, got married in the Satya Yuga today. Therefore, there is a belief that you do not have to go to the site today to get married. The beginning of the Tretayuga is also a scriptural word from today. This date is called Akshay Tritiya as the good deeds done on this day will bring inexhaustible fruit.

Parashuram Jayanti

The birth anniversary of sage Parashuram, who was born on the day of Akshay III, is also celebrated today. It is mentioned in various mythological texts that Parashuram, one of the Ashtchiranjeevis, was born on the evening of the third day. Parashurama was born as the sixth incarnation of Lord Vishnu.

It is also explained in the scriptures that sage Jamadagni and Renuka's son Parashuram killed mother Renuka on the orders of father Jamadagni. It is mentioned that after father Jamadagni asked Parashuram for a bridegroom, he asked others not to know that he had killed his mother alive.

Parashuram, one of the Ashtchiranjeevis, had traveled around the world 21 times after the assassination of his father Jamadagni. Theologian Gautam says that he was born as the sixth incarnation of Lord Vishnu to protect the saint and kill the villain after the ego began to grow in the region. All the sons of King Kartavirya were killed by Parashuram.
